Malaysia-Arm Ltd cooperation targets 5,000 chip designers by 2027

Economy minister Akmal Nasir said several universities have agreed to integrate Arm’s training into their academic programmes. (Bernama pic)

PETALING JAYA: At least 5,000 local talents will be trained in Arm Ltd technology by the end of 2027, with the partnership funnelled towards a Made-in-Malaysia chip, says economy minister Akmal Nasir.

Speaking at his ministry’s monthly assembly today, Akmal said the target is an important benchmark towards the commitment to train 10,000 talents over the next four years under the Malaysia-Arm partnership, Bernama reported.

He said 1,530 participants have undergone training linked with the British semiconductor tech company so far, with the four-year target requiring an average of 2,500 new talents in circuit design each year.

Akmal said discussions with 12 universities last week showed that they have the capacity to collectively train at least 2,500 designers annually, to support chip design, and beyond, using Arm technology.

He said several universities have agreed to integrate Arm’s training into their academic programmes, including in their students’ respective fields of study.

The strategic partnership will incorporate Arm expertise into the universities’ industrial training and internship modules, as well as final-year projects.

He said those who complete their training with Arm Ltd will also have the opportunity to undergo industrial training with companies that have Arm Flexible Access (AFA) tokens.

The technology access is to help local R&D and manufacturing of integrated circuit design for products like drones and microelectronics, to bring Made-in-Malaysia chips to the global supply chain.

“We do not want our young people, after gaining exposure, to be recruited for work in other countries or foreign companies, while local firms claim that talent is unavailable, insufficient or difficult to find,” he said.

AFA tokens provide companies with early, lower-cost access to Arm’s chip designs, allowing them to experiment, develop and test products without paying full licensing fees upfront.
